Key Points
Motor imitation deficits were observed alongside altered cortical activation in children with autism spectrum disorder.
fNIRS imaging showed significant differences in brain activity during motor tasks associated with imitation.
Assessment focused on preschool-aged children, enhancing our understanding of early neural markers of autism.
Findings highlight the importance of addressing motor imitation in therapeutic strategies for autism spectrum disorder.
